Ashwagandha and Heart Health: Impact on Blood Pressure, Cholesterol, and Cardiovascular Wellness
Abstract Summary
Objective
This study investigates the relationship between ashwagandha supplementation and its impact on heart health, focusing on blood pressure regulation, cholesterol levels, and overall cardiovascular health.
Context
Ashwagandha (Withania somnifera), a popular adaptogenic herb, is renowned for its stress-reducing properties and general wellness benefits. Recent research suggests that it may also play a role in heart health, particularly in lowering stress-related cardiovascular risk factors. While ashwagandha has been shown to influence cortisol levels, its effects on heart health, including blood pressure, lipid profiles, and heart disease prevention, warrant further examination. This research examines the available scientific evidence concerning ashwagandha’s role in heart health.
Methods Used
Approach
The study utilizes both experimental methods and a comprehensive literature review to explore ashwagandha's potential cardiovascular benefits. Experimental methods included clinical trials involving individuals taking ashwagandha supplements for 6-12 weeks, with a focus on monitoring heart rate, blood pressure, cholesterol levels, and inflammatory markers. A literature review was conducted to analyze the findings from previous studies on ashwagandha and its effects on heart health, particularly focusing on randomized controlled trials and meta-analyses.
Data Collection
Data were collected through monitoring changes in systolic and diastolic blood pressure, lipid profiles (total cholesterol, LDL, HDL, and triglycerides), and heart rate variability (HRV) in participants taking ashwagandha supplements. Researchers also gathered data on inflammatory markers, such as C-reactive protein (CRP), to assess the potential anti-inflammatory benefits of ashwagandha on cardiovascular health. Studies on animal models and human trials were reviewed to provide additional context and depth to the findings.
Researchers' Summary of Findings
Impact on Health
The experimental findings suggest that ashwagandha supplementation has a significant impact on lowering both systolic and diastolic blood pressure in individuals with high-stress levels or mild hypertension. Ashwagandha’s adaptogenic properties were shown to improve heart rate variability, indicating a positive effect on autonomic nervous system balance. Regarding cholesterol, some studies indicated that ashwagandha supplementation may lead to reduced total cholesterol and triglycerides, while increasing beneficial HDL cholesterol. Additionally, ashwagandha has demonstrated potential anti-inflammatory effects, with reductions in CRP levels observed in several studies, suggesting a heart-healthy anti-inflammatory benefit.
Health Implications
Ashwagandha supplementation can be considered beneficial for individuals dealing with stress-induced cardiovascular risks. It may help reduce blood pressure, improve lipid profiles, and lower inflammation, all of which contribute to better heart health. For individuals with high stress or mild hypertension, ashwagandha can be an effective, natural adjunct to managing heart health alongside other lifestyle modifications. However, individuals with more severe cardiovascular conditions should consult a healthcare provider before incorporating ashwagandha into their routine.
